I thought that a youtuber playing France in the first game declared war on Germany for reoccupying the Rhineland. That is what shot the world tension up high enough for the U.S.(Johan) to join the war. I think most of us wouldn't DOW Germany for the Rhineland in a serious game.

The biggest issue wasn't that they dowed Germany for that, but that they got way too much WT from it. 50%. :D Dowing Germany for the Rhineland is supposed to give way less than that.

I am sure the interface could be improved although it seemed fairly quick and easy to move and direct a large airforce in the video posted by one of the participants. It is unsettling, however, to hear that having to order the airforce to attack bombers or aim for air supremacy is unreasonable to the point where this person prefers not to employ the airforce at all. If the player should not be bothered with such a thing in this game I ask what on earth they SHOULD do? What is left that would be important enough to bother with?

They keep complaining about the game not telling them what to do. I do not want a game which tells me what to do! What is the point of that? If I do what the game tells me to do the game could just as well do it and I can go read a book. A game should tell me how to do things, not what to do. If You need to be instructed in what to do to prepare for war You should not play a grand strategy game. They grow bored because they do not know what to do and go to war straight away because the game did not tell them to do something else. Then they complain about the war starting too soon and strange effects such as the war ending early. If You make stupid decisions You should be punished by consequences. A game which will not punish You with these consequences is one where Your actions are irrelevant and THAT is a truly bad game.

They keep making irrelevant comparisons to EU and CK over and over again, complaining about not being able to recover from losing a war because they do not have hundreds of years to fight a dozen more wars and they keep wishing for HOI to be more like EU. Why on earth would one want a WWII game to be like EU?

These people are clearly not interested in the type of game HOI has to be given the theme. It would be a mistake to allow people who dislike a certain type of game to influence how that type of game is designed. We would end up with Command and conquer WWII. Bleh!
